New electricity tariff for traders on the cards

ISLAMABAD: Caretaker Minister for Energy, Power and Petroleum Muhammad Ali has said that a new electricity tariff will be introduced for traders before October 31.
Talking to the media, he said that discussions have taken place with traders in Karachi and before October 31, a new electricity tariff will be introduced for businessmen.
He, however, said that permission will need to be sought from the International Monetary Fund to reduce electricity prices.
He said that rampant theft and the increasing value of the dollar were the main cause of rising cost of electricity in the country.
The interim minister said that steps were being taken to curb electricity theft. He said that some officials have been replaced, and the process of recovery has also begun.
Ali said that efforts are being made to ensure the provision of gas for industries during winters.
Efforts are underway to combat electricity theft without discrimination.
